Hugo Armando Campagnaro (* June 27, 1980 in Córdoba ) is an Argentine football player who is under contract with the Italian club Inter Milan since the summer of 2013.

Club career

Campagnaro learned to play football in youth Deportivo Morón in Argentina as a defender. In 2002, it bought Piacenza Calcio. He made his debut for the Emilianer on 22 September 2002 in the Serie A match against Udinese Calcio. On 27 April 2003, he scored his first Serie A goal for Piacenza. After relegation to Serie B Campagnaro remained the club for four years faithfully until 2007, he moved to Sampdoria and for a limited four-year contract signed with the Genoese club.

On August 16, 2007 the second round of the UEFA Cup group stage, he scored against Hajduk Split his first goal for the Blucerchiati. After a short time he became a favorite of fans of Sampdoria player. After a good start to the season, the Argentinean injured on 27 January 2008 at the league match against Atalanta at the right calf muscles and fell for several months through injury. In a friendly match against FC Chiasso early July 2008, he injured his back in the right calf and fell for two months. It was only on 27 November 2008, in the group stage of the UEFA Cup against VfB Stuttgart, Campagnaro could play for Sampdoria again. However, in early January 2009, he was injured again on the right calf and paused again a few weeks.

In early July 2009 Campagnaro moved to Sampdoria League rivals Napoli, where he signed a contract until 2013. He made his debut for the Southern Italians on 16 August 2009 at the cup match against Salernitana Calcio, the game ended with a 3-0 victory for the Partenopei. March 21, 2010 the Defense succeeded in the away match against AC Milan, his first scoring for Naples, the game ended in a 1-1 draw. With the southerners the Argentine won the Coppa Italia in 2012, where he was in the final against Juventus over the full 90 minutes on the court. He was also with Naples in the season 2012/13 Italian runners-up.

After the expiry of his contract with the southerners Campagnaro changed in the summer of 2013 free transfer to Inter Milan, where he signed in 2015.

National

On February 29, 2012, he celebrated his national team debut for Argentina, where he was in the starting and playing 90 minutes. Argentina won the game 3-1 with a hat-trick by Lionel Messi.
